  1. I have a 97' LX450 and the steering wheels shakes while braking. I just balanced the wheels and replaced the rear rotors and pads about 6 months ago with no improvement so I can eliminate those things. Also checked the steering and everything seems OK, the steering feels tight except on bumpy surfaces which I think is normal for this truck, any way check if the tie rod ends are bad? I also pulled the front wheels and spun the rotors but could not see a visible sign of warping? Is warping detectable just by looking? Any other possible causes? If I were to change the front rotors and pads what's a good after market combo to avoid future warping? Any special tools needed to change the front rotors?
